The Latest... on food and lifestyle
Read moreCan the stress of modern life be beaten by the taste of ancient herbs and spices? The question has been posed by two of our major newspapers because of a surge of interest in plants from around the globe that have been called adaptogens. They are all said to control stress by regulating the release of the hormone cortisol from the adrenal gland.

The Story of the Brazil Nut
Read moreThe Brazil nut has an interesting background story, as it is a natural uncultivated product that is collected from the wild on the banks of the Amazon river. The production relies on the crop that the trees in the rain forest provide. Whatever level of volume comes out of the forest, that is what can be processed, while conserving the rain forest and providing for the communities living in the forest.
